IR8xx IOS GPS configuration

Before one can start using GPS service, one needs to configure IOS to start streaming the GPS NMEA data.Below are the steps

  • Connect GPS antenna to the IR8xx router
  • Configure IOS GPS feature and ensure GPS fix

IOS GPS Configuration

Check if the GPS feature is already enabled on the router by running the below command on the IOS console:


    IR829#show cellular 0 gps
  • Follow the below steps to configure the GPS feature on the IR 8xx router *
    iox-ir809-03(config)#controller cellular 0
    iox-ir809-03(config-controller)#lte gps ?
    iox-ir809-03(config-controller)#lte gps enable	
    iox-ir809-03(config-controller)#lte gps mode standalone 
    iox-ir809-03(config-controller)#lte gps nmea serial

After adding the configuration. Do a modem power cycle using the following command.

iox-ir809-03#test cellular 0 modem-power-cycle

Please ensure that the GPS antenna has a good line of sight to the sky for getting a good fix to the GPS satellites.

When the GPS feature has a successful fix, the IOS CLI shows GPS data as below

    IR829#show cellular 0 gps

    GPS Info
    -------------
    GPS Feature: enabled
    GPS Port Selected: Dedicated GPS port
    GPS State: GPS enabled
    GPS Mode Configured: standalone
    Latitude: 48 Deg 38 Min 31.2114 Sec North
    Longitude: 2 Deg 13 Min 47.3992 Sec East
    Timestamp (GMT): Wed Jul 22 08:05:28 2015
     
    Fix type index: 0, Height: 94 m
